Decoding the Digital World: Understanding How the Internet Works in Everyday Life

Cloud computing refers to the delivery of computing services—such as storage, processing, and software—over the Internet. Users can access these services on-demand without managing physical hardware or installing software locally.

Cloud services are often categorized into three types:
– Infrastructure as a Service (IaaS): Provides virtualized computing resources over the Internet.
– Platform as a Service (PaaS): Offers hardware and software tools for application development.
– Software as a Service (SaaS): Delivers software applications over the Internet, typically on a subscription basis.

Cloud computing relies on data centres and virtualization technology to allocate resources dynamically. This enables scalability and flexibility for users, who can adjust their service usage based on current needs.


Benefits and Applications
The benefits of cloud computing include cost savings, as users pay only for what they use; increased productivity, with the ability to collaborate in real-time; and enhanced security, with data backups and disaster recovery often provided by the service.

Applications of cloud computing are widespread, from personal file storage services like Dropbox and Google Drive to enterprise solutions like Amazon Web Services (AWS) and Microsoft Azure. These platforms support a range of applications, including data analysis, artificial intelligence (AI), and Internet of Things (IoT) devices.